I was reading USA Today when I came across this article.
On June 2005 29 year old Lt Michael Murphy was shot in the back while making a call for help. His last words over the radio were "Roger that, sir. Thank you." This brave wounded man move himself into the line of fire to make this radio call while his 4 men SEAL team was being over ran by 50 plus anti-coalitin fighters. After being shot in the back and dropping his radio, he picked it up completed the call. Lt Murphy returned to his position with his men and continued fighting. A U.S. helicopter sent to rescue them was hit by an RPG, killing all 16 aboard. Yesterday his parents were given the Medal of Honor by President Bush. After reading the article I looked down to see this figure, and could not belive the resemblance this figure had to Lt Murphy. So I put this together as a reminder that as the Holidays grow near remember those who will never come home. Rest in Peace my friend and Thank you.
